We use cookies to improve your experience on this website. Read More Allow Cookies

 

MeliĆ” San Carlos is located in the historic heart of Cienfuegos, Cuba. Accommodation options feature comfortably furnished rooms and suites with air conditioning, flat-screen TVs, safes, private bathrooms, and hairdryers. Facilities and services include event/meeting spaces, a restaurant, bars, and Wi-Fi.

IMAGE GALLERY